Kansas City

Infrastructure Highlights

  • Modern rail interchanges linking Kansas City to major U.S. seaports on the Gulf and Pacific coasts
  • Regional logistics parks supporting nationwide ground freight consolidation and deconsolidation
  • Regular air freight connections via Kansas City International Airport to key domestic hubs
  • Efficient highway and rail systems along Interstates I-35, I-70, and I-29 for north–south and east–west freight flows

Key Imports

Consumer goods and retail merchandiseElectronics and appliancesAutomotive components and finished vehicles (via rail from coastal ports)Industrial inputs and raw materialsBuilding materials and construction products

Import Regulations

Most ocean-borne imports clear customs at coastal ports and then move inland to Kansas City for distribution
